本帖最后由 neycwby09 于 2013-10-6 22:12 编辑
方法来源: 核心工具:dmtest(提取自:apple官方的Lion Recovery Update v1.0)这里已经提取出来了直接下附件好了 核心命令行: sudo dmtest ensureRecoveryPartition / /Volumes/OS\ X\ Install\ ESD/BaseSystem.dmg 0 0 /Volumes/OS\ X\ Install\ ESD/BaseSystem.chunklist
- sudo dmtest ensureRecoveryPartition / /Volumes/OS\ X\ Install\ ESD/BaseSystem.dmg 0 0 /Volumes/OS\ X\ Install\ ESD/BaseSystem.chunklist
复制代码
另外 dmtest 你放在哪了 就需要在终端里输入完整路径 也可以直接拽着dmtest拖入到终端 免去输入路径的麻烦 镜像也可以拖进去
现在加载Install_10.9_GM.dmg 在加载/Volumes/Install OS X Mavericks/Install OS X Mavericks.app/Contents/SharedSupport/InstallESD.dmg
Recovery HD分区的加载命令: diskutil mount Recovery\ HD
Recovery HD的目录结构 └── com.apple.recovery.boot ├── .disk_label ├── .disk_label_2x ├── BaseSystem.chunklist ├── BaseSystem.dmg ├── PlatformSupport.plist ├── SystemVersion.plist ├── boot.efi ├── com.apple.Boot.plist └── kernelcache
执行前后的变化: 之前 $ diskutil list
/dev/disk0
#: TYPE NAME SIZE IDENTIFIER
0: GUID_partition_scheme *128.0 GB disk0
1: EFI IN_EFI 209.7 MB disk0s1
2: Apple_HFS Mavericks 51.2 GB disk0s2
3: Microsoft Basic Data Win7 10.8 GB disk0s4
4: Microsoft Basic Data DATA 65.7 GB disk0s5
之后 $ diskutil list
/dev/disk0
#: TYPE NAME SIZE IDENTIFIER
0: GUID_partition_scheme *128.0 GB disk0
1: EFI IN_EFI 209.7 MB disk0s1
2: Apple_HFS Mavericks 50.7 GB disk0s2
3: Apple_Boot Recovery HD 650.0 MB disk0s3
4: Microsoft Basic Data Win7 10.8 GB disk0s4
5: Microsoft Basic Data DATA 65.7 GB disk0s5
|